Transaction 59856b2fd5f7c3d8aa26599a9583b4a416fb1f5410d9b70571f4db92e290cbc7
1 Input
1 Output
-
59856b2fd5f7c3d8aa26599a9583b4a416fb1f5410d9b70571f4db92e290cbc7:0
- value
- 1739128
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f26ad60d4aeb2f86c958a5d55b76e46ebedb2a17 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P6nWXdd13rQv29ydwaf2RBGEFtKbg4XbL